Description
The Transaction Manager is responsible for overseeing the end-to-end mortgage loan acquisition process, ensuring accuracy, efficiency, and timely execution. This role manages the acquisition pipeline, resolves aged production issues, responds to diligence requests, and drives continuous improvement in systems and processes. Additionally, the Transaction Manager supports client training and cultivates strong relationships across internal teams and external partners.
The ideal candidate brings strong analytical skills, hands-on experience in operational acquisition and securitization, and a track record of addressing both business and technical challenges. Success in this role requires excellent communication and interpersonal skills, a proactive, analytical and detail-oriented mindset, and the ability to thrive both independently and in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.

Invictus Capital Partners, LP (“Invictus”), a leading investment firm, and its subsidiary Verus Residential Loanco, LLC (“Verus,” and together with Invictus, the “Companies”), manage and oversee investments in Non-Agency single family residential mortgage loans. Invictus is located in Washington, D.C. and has approximately 50 employees, and Verus is located in Minneapolis and has approximately 200 employees. The Companies have overseen the acquisition of over $38 billion of mortgage loans since their inception. In addition, Invictus manages over $19 billion in gross assets and has completed over 70 rated securitizations.
